Chemical & Physical Properties
|
CAS Number |
21414-41-5 |
Density |
1.78±0.1g/cm3 (20 ℃ 760 Torr) |
|
Molecular Formula |
C12H23NO10S3 |
Molecular Weight |
437.51 |
|
Solubleness |
Methanol (slightly soluble), water (slightly soluble) |
Test Method |
HPLC |

The efficient extraction of sulforaphane relies heavily on the selection of specific raw materials. Studies have shown that broccoli seeds and directionally cultivated broccoli sprouts (such as three-day-old broccoli seedlings) are the richest sites for this component, with sulforaphane content reaching tens or even hundreds of times higher than that of mature plants such as the corolla, stems, and leaves. Therefore, industrial extraction and high-purity preparation processes typically prioritize these high-content biological materials as starting materials to achieve optimal yields.

Process Flowchart
Broccoli seeds or specially cultivated shoots are used as raw materials, and water is used as a solvent for extraction. After filtering to remove solid residue, the extract is concentrated to increase the concentration of active ingredients, and then dried to obtain extract powder.
The dried extract powder is mixed and sieved to ensure uniform composition and control particle size. Inner packaging follows. During packaging, samples are simultaneously taken for quality testing. After passing the tests, outer packaging is completed, and the product is stored in the warehouse.

Benefits of Glucoraphanin
1. Stable Activity
Broccoli Seed Extract's molecular structure is stable, allowing for better preservation during storage and processing. Once in the human body, it is gradually hydrolyzed into highly bioactive sulforaphane by intestinal flora or myrosinase added to supplements. This "produce" property allows for more efficient delivery of the active ingredient into the body, avoiding the instability issues inherent in sulforaphane itself.

2. Support for Liver Detoxification and Metabolic Health
The detoxification enzymes it induces significantly enhance the liver's ability to metabolize and clear various exogenous and endogenous toxins. Studies have shown that this mechanism helps improve the body's excretion of pollutants and may have a positive impact on maintaining healthy blood sugar and lipid levels by regulating metabolism and reducing inflammation.
3. Potential Cardiovascular and Neuroprotective Effects
Through its downstream antioxidant and anti-inflammatory effects, glucosamine helps protect vascular endothelial function, reduces the risk of atherosclerosis, and provides protection for brain neurons. Epidemiological studies suggest that long-term consumption of vegetables rich in this substance is associated with a reduced risk of certain cardiovascular diseases and neurodegenerative diseases such as Alzheimer's disease.

4. The Foundation of Cancer Chemoprevention
This is one of the most in-depth research areas. Through multi-stage action—including initiating detoxification, inhibiting carcinogen activation, inducing apoptosis, and inhibiting angiogenesis—it and its derivatives have shown preventive potential against various cancers (such as prostate cancer, breast cancer, and colon cancer) in preclinical models and are considered important dietary cancer-preventive components.

Safety of Glucoraphanin
Glucoraphanin obtained from the diet (primarily from cruciferous vegetables such as broccoli) are generally considered very safe. They are naturally occurring components in these vegetables, and long-term consumption is associated with a variety of health benefits with no known toxicity.When used as a supplement in standardized extract form, their safety profile remains high, but the following points should be noted:
Gastrointestinal reactions: A small number of sensitive individuals may experience mild bloating, gas, or abdominal discomfort at high doses. Theoretical risk to thyroid function, Its metabolites may interfere with iodine utilization. Individuals with pre-existing thyroid disease or severe iodine deficiency should consult a doctor before long-term use of high-dose supplements. Drug interactions, Glucoraphanin, through their active metabolite (sulforaphane), induce phase II detoxification enzymes in the liver, which theoretically may accelerate the clearance of certain drugs metabolized via the same pathway (such as some anticoagulants and sedatives), thus affecting their efficacy. Those currently taking such medications should exercise particular caution.

FAQ
Q1:Is glucoraphanin the same as sulforaphane?
A1:No, they are related as precursors and active products.Glucosamine is a stable compound naturally found in vegetables such as broccoli and does not possess biological activity itself. When plant tissue is damaged (e.g., by cutting or chewing), it is hydrolyzed into bioactive sulforaphane by endogenous myrosinase.Therefore, what we ingest is glucosamine, while the powerful ant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, and other health benefits it provides are its final product, sulforaphane.
Q2:What is glucoraphanin converted to in our body?
A2:In the human body, glucosinolates are primarily converted into their biologically active end product—sulforaphane.This conversion process relies on myrosinase, an enzyme naturally present in gut microbiota or certain plant tissues. This enzyme hydrolyzes stable glucosinolates, releasing the potent active molecule sulforaphane.Sulforaphane is the substance that exerts core health effects; it activates the body's own antioxidant and detoxification defense systems, thus providing various benefits such as cell protection and anti-inflammation. Therefore, glucosinolates are considered a key precursor nutrient.
